Questions, answered.
- What is Accenture's income before provision for income taxes?
- Accenture (ACN) reported income before provision for income taxes of $3.15B in Q1 2026.
- How has Accenture's income before provision for income taxes changed year-over-year?
- Accenture's income before provision for income taxes increased by 6.7% year-over-year, from $2.95B to $3.15B.
- What is the long-term trend for Accenture's income before provision for income taxes?
-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), Accenture's income before provision for income taxes has grown at a 7.3%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$7.76B to $10.27B.
- What does income before provision for income taxes mean?
- This metric represents the total earnings generated from ongoing business operations before the deduction of income tax expenses. It serves as a primary indicator of operational profitability by excluding the impact of tax jurisdictions and non-recurring items. Investors use this to assess the core performance of the business before tax-related accounting adjustments.
